2026 Episode 5: Huskers In The Sweet 16! Cary Cochran Interview
Episode 280
Wednesday, 25 March, 2026

In this episode of the Husker Doc Talk Podcast, Travis Justice and Dr. Rob Zatechka are joined by former Husker sharpshooter Cary Cochran to celebrate a historic milestone: Nebraska’s deep run into the Sweet 16. Recorded on the eve of their high-stakes matchup against Iowa in Houston, the conversation captures a fan base and a program operating on "house money," balanced by the anxiety of a storied regional rivalry. The conversation centers on the transformative culture under Fred Hoiberg, a coach whose reputation has soared to the point where Cochran jokes they might soon build him a statue in Lincoln. The trio discusses how this particular roster has defied the "curse" of Nebraska basketball by embracing a brand of unselfishness that overcomes their lack of traditional first-round NBA talent. Cochran highlights the team's recent hot streak, noting that when the Huskers shoot as well as they have lately, specifically, their performance against teams like Vanderbilt, they become a threat to anyone in the country. A significant portion of the discussion focuses on the tactical and emotional weight of the Sweet 16 appearance. Cochran posits that Nebraska's cohesiveness is their greatest strength, allowing it to play at a level that "out-shoots" more talented opponents. He predicts a double-digit victory over the Hawkeyes, citing that Nebraska played poorly in its previous loss at Iowa and still nearly won, whereas it dominated at home. The conversation also touches on the broader implications of this success for the program's future. The hosts and Cochran speculate that this tournament run will finally trigger the necessary NIL investment in basketball, a move they deem essential if the program hopes to keep its developed talent from being poached by higher-paying schools. Amidst the excitement of being just "40 minutes from the Final Four," the episode serves as a tribute to a program that has finally traded its history of first-round exits for a seat at the "big kids' table" of college basketball.
